Being acclaimed as one of the world heritage rivers, the kwai Noi maintains a variety of per-historicn evidences. Extending from the west forest of Thailand, this heritage river experienced a menorandum of the history of the Thai-Burmese war at the beginning of the Thai-Burmese war at the beginning of the Rattanakosin period. Moreover, the river has been widely reputed again during the World war II by the Death Railway and the Bridge over the River Kwai. The legend of travelling along the Kwai Noi can be traced back 100 years ago from the Royal Visit of King Rama V, which in turn originated the popular Thai classical music of Khmer Sai Yoke. Since then, the Kwai Noi river has been preserving this travelling legend due to its most exquisite and unspoilt landscapes, including the original lifestyles of
